We are the UK’s only NetSuite and Business Central Partner. In business since 1988 and with over fifteen years of experience in migrating businesses to the cloud.
Nolan are a trusted ERP adviser with qualified technical resource and 1,300+ active customers worldwide. Nolan provide ERP consultancy, development, support and training and have a range of forward-thinking custom-built ERP solutions.
Job description:
We are looking for a motivated, passionate Software Developer to design and develop software solutions. You will be expected to write well designed, testable, efficient code, as well as producing functional designs, specifications and time estimates.
Our work can vary greatly from project to project and as such you will be expected to learn a variety of environments and languages, as well as the financial systems into which we deploy.
Responsibilities:
Software Development
Developing and maintaining Nolan SuiteApp’s and customer specific development projects according to user requirements
Writing and implementing high quality, efficient and well documented code using Nolan standard practises
Testing software, code reviewing other scrum team members work and actively contributing to the continuous improvement ethos within the team
Liaising with customers to ascertain requirements, with ad hoc on-site travel as required
Working with the support team to investigate and resolve bugs and issues in existing software
Agile Development Contribution
To develop software within the NetSuite SCRUM team on the NetSuite platform according to the sprint priority
Suggest tasks changes on user stories in sprint items
Knowledge acquisition and transfers
Take an active and supportive role helping junior developers and other colleagues learn new features and techniques
Continuously improving knowledge and staying up to date with the latest development techniques and technology
Contributing to new standard practises and identifying where improvements could be made
Others
Accurately recording time weekly using NetSuite timesheets
Any other duties commensurate with the level of this post as requested by management
Skills and Competencies
Essential:
Solid experience as a software developer
Work under own initiative
Good problem solver and communication skills
Experience of working with NetSuite components with solid portfolio:
SuiteBuilder, SuiteFlow, SuiteBundle
SuiteScripts in both 1.0 and 2.x,
Map/Reduce terminology
Certified in Netsuite Foundation
Desirable:
Certified in Netsuite Developer
Experience of financial systems
Knowledge on Netsuite SDF deployment, SOAP / REST
Along with the above, you should be willing to share ideas, learn new technology, be enthusiastic about your work, be able to work on your own initiative and develop close and sustainable relationships with your clients and colleagues.
Why work for Nolan Business Solutions?
At Nolan Business Solutions we are driven by our company culture and core values: Quality, Respect, and Integrity.
Our values guide every decision we make to ensure we maintain the highest levels of customer service and help create an environment that is great to work within. Every employee has the opportunity to progress and feel supported in the process.
Birthday off
Industry leading salary
Annual flexible bonus
Private medical insurance
Casual dress code
Pension scheme with employer contributions
Annual Christmas and summer parties
22 days holiday, increasing annually up to 25 days
Perkbox subscription
Training and development opportunities
Free car parking at head office
One day off per year to take part in a charity event or initiative
We use cookies to enhance your online browsing experience. By continuing to use this site, you agree to accept our use of cookies. Read our Privacy Statement to find out more.
var _glc =_glc || []; _glc.push('all_ag9zfmNsaWNrZGVza2NoYXRyDwsSBXVzZXJzGMTP7pYDDA');
var glcpath = (('https:' == document.location.protocol) ? 'https://my.clickdesk.com/clickdesk-ui/browser/' :
'http://my.clickdesk.com/clickdesk-ui/browser/');
var glcp = (('https:' == document.location.protocol) ? 'https://' : 'http://');
var glcspt = document.createElement('script'); glcspt.type = 'text/javascript';
glcspt.async = true; glcspt.src = glcpath + 'livechat-new.js';
var s = document.getElementsByTagName('script')[0];s.parentNode.insertBefore(glcspt, s);